White scabs vs red scabs after implantation
I've seen both kinds of scabs after surgery, does anyone know the cause of this? Perhaps the solution the grafts are stored in after harvesting?
-
Moderator
They are the same. When red scabs are visible, they're dry. When they're white, they're wet. They absorb moisture when you're showering after your surgery and when you see them in photos where the patient is still in the chair, it means the techs were pressure washing the scalp, so again, they absorbed the moisture.
